Job Description:

A Refreshment Mechanic at American Food & Vending will ensure machines are functioning at the highest quality, order parts, and keep service records.

Job Responsibility:

  • Repair, maintain, and install vending machines and beverage dispensers for water and coffee
  • Perform routine checks on motors, keypads, and other equipment to make sure machines are functioning at the highest quality
  • Maintaining vending inventories, order repair parts and keep service records
  • Connect water pipes and electrical wires
  • ensure that installations are compliant with plumbing, electrical and sanitation codes and standards
  • Conduct routine maintenance
  • clean and oil machine parts and adjust machine pressure gauges and thermostats
  • Respond to service calls by taking a preliminary visual survey to look for loose wires or leaks. If no clear problem is found, technicians may use diagnostic equipment and other aids to find the source and extent of the malfunction
  • Transport machines to the repair shop for maintenance and inspection as needed
  • May be assigned other duties and responsibilities as needed

Requirements:

  • Technical school, Certification, or an associate degree in related field preferred
  • 3+ years of relevant experience with POS or Kiosk preferred
  • Basic knowledge of microprocessors, integrated circuits, robotics, and automated functions
  • Lifting, bending, walking, driving, climbing stairs
  • able to lift 40+ lbs. as needed
  • Possess a valid state driver's license that is in good standing
